How automation advances, hygienic design expectations, and modular product strategies are reshaping supplier roadmaps and buyer procurement priorities in cheese processing

The landscape for commercial electric cheese grating machines is undergoing transformative shifts driven by three converging forces: technological maturation of automation, heightened compliance expectations for sanitation and traceability, and evolving customer models that prioritize flexibility and modularity. Automation has matured from simple motorized shredding units to integrated systems that combine variable-speed drives, sensor feedback for throughput consistency, and modular cutting assemblies designed for rapid changeover between cheese types. As a result, operations that once relied on manual labor can now scale output with improved uniformity and reduced product loss.

Concurrently, regulatory and buyer-led demands have elevated hygienic design from a competitive advantage to a baseline requirement. Smooth surfaces, tool-less disassembly for cleaning, and components specified in food-grade alloys are now central to equipment selection conversations. These design priorities are reinforced by major buyers and cold-chain partners who increasingly require verifiable cleaning cycles and component traceability. In parallel, sustainability mandates and corporate ESG programs are pressuring vendors to demonstrate reduced energy consumption and recyclable materials in machine construction, pushing suppliers to innovate around motor efficiency and end-of-life recovery planning.

Finally, shifting commercial models have placed a premium on flexibility. Customers now ask for equipment capable of handling a wider range of cheese types-from soft and processed varieties to very hard cheeses-without extended downtime for retooling. This trend favors modular product architectures that can be upgraded or adapted rather than replaced. Taken together, these shifts are reorienting product roadmaps, pursuing incremental engineering refinements that accelerate adoption and enhance long-term operational resilience for end users.

How 2025 tariff adjustments are prompting suppliers to reconfigure sourcing strategies, substitute components, and expand refurbishment services to stabilize total landed costs

Tariff changes enacted in 2025 have introduced new cost considerations for manufacturers, distributors, and commercial purchasers of electric cheese grating equipment, influencing sourcing decisions and supply chain design. The immediate commercial effect has been to increase the relative attractiveness of regional sourcing and local manufacturing capacities, as well as to prompt suppliers to reassess bill-of-materials strategies to mitigate tariff exposure. In response, several manufacturers have sought to recompose supplier networks, prioritize domestic fabrication of high-tariff components, and negotiate long-term contracts with trusted sub-suppliers to stabilize input pricing.

Beyond procurement adjustments, tariff pressure has accelerated two strategic responses in the industry. First, some firms have expanded engineering efforts to substitute tariff-sensitive components with alternatives that retain performance but are sourced from lower-duty jurisdictions. Second, there has been an uptick in maintenance and refurbishment offerings designed to extend the lifecycle of existing equipment as a means of delaying capital-intensive replacements that would be subject to higher import duties. Both responses reflect a pragmatic shift toward cost containment while preserving service levels for end users.

Looking forward, the tariff environment has also made clarity around total landed cost more important to buyers. Procurement teams are demanding greater transparency around component origin, duty classifications, and potential mitigation strategies such as bonded warehousing or deferred importation. This heightened scrutiny is prompting suppliers to enhance documentation practices, certify alternative supply routes, and, in some cases, offer bundled solutions that internalize tariff risk for key accounts. The broader implication is that tariff dynamics are influencing not only price but the architecture of supplier relationships and the structuring of aftermarket services.

Detailed segmentation analysis showing how operation modes, cheese types, product forms, end-user verticals, and distribution channels drive procurement choices and product design

Key segmentation insights reveal how buyer requirements, product engineering, and distribution models intersect across power and operation types, material distinctions, product form factors, end-user verticals, and distribution channels. When considering power and operation type, the contrast between Fully Automatic and Semi-Automatic machines defines trade-offs between throughput, operator skill requirements, and maintenance complexity. Fully Automatic solutions appeal to large-scale processors and high-volume foodservice operations because they minimize direct labor and can be integrated into continuous production lines. Semi-Automatic units remain relevant for smaller dairies and specialty retailers where capital intensity must be balanced against intermittent production runs and simpler cleaning regimes.

Material type drives both mechanical specification and sanitation protocols. Fresh Cheese Graters, Hard Cheese Graters, Processed Cheese Graters, and Soft Cheese Graters each impose distinct wear patterns, cutter geometries, and flow-handling characteristics that influence rotor design, feed mechanics, and selection of food-contact materials. For instance, equipment intended for hard cheeses typically requires more robust drive trains and hardened cutting surfaces, whereas machines for soft and fresh cheeses prioritize gentle handling, anti-clogging features, and more frequent disassembly for cleaning. These material-driven differences also affect aftermarket inventories and spare-parts strategies.

Product type segmentation-Automatic Cheese Graters, Countertop Cheese Graters, Industrial Cheese Graters, and Manual Cheese Graters-maps directly to intended scale of use and installation environments. Automatic and industrial units are engineered for line integration and higher duty cycles, with features such as variable-speed control and hardened bearings. Countertop and manual designs emphasize compact footprints, user ergonomics, and lower energy draw, making them suited to retail demonstrations, catering service kitchens, and smaller-scale specialty production.

End-user industry segmentation clarifies how functional requirements vary across Dairy Processing, Food Service, and Retail sectors. Within Dairy Processing, artisanal producers prioritize versatility and ease of sanitation for small batches, while large-scale processors demand consistent throughput, automated cleaning protocols, and integration with downstream packaging systems. Food Service customers such as catering services and hotels/restaurants value reliability, rapid changeover between menu items, and safe operation in environments with varied staff skills. Retail applications, including specialty stores and supermarkets, require equipment that supports small-batch production, minimal footprint, and aesthetics that align with front-of-house presentation.

Distribution channel choices-Direct Sales, Distributors, and Online Retail-shape how products are marketed, serviced, and delivered. Direct sales models favor large accounts that require customization, integration support, and long-term service contracts. Distributors serve regional markets where localized inventory and installation expertise reduce lead times, while online retail has expanded reach for standardized countertop and manual units, enabling manufacturers to access specialty retailers and small operators with lower friction. Each channel imposes different requirements for warranty structures, spare-parts logistics, and training delivery, and manufacturers must align channel strategy with product segmentation to ensure consistent post-sale experience.

How regional regulatory profiles, service infrastructures, and retail dynamics across the Americas, Europe Middle East & Africa, and Asia-Pacific shape supplier priorities and buyer selection

Regional dynamics reflect distinct demand drivers, regulatory frameworks, and supply-chain architectures across the Americas, Europe, Middle East & Africa, and Asia-Pacific, each influencing strategic priorities for manufacturers and buyers. In the Americas, emphasis is placed on operational scalability, integration with large-scale processing lines, and compliance with rigorous sanitary guidelines. Manufacturers serving this region often need to demonstrate robust aftermarket support, rapid parts availability, and local installation expertise to meet the needs of both industrial processors and fast-moving foodservice customers.

In Europe, Middle East & Africa, regulatory complexity and diverse customer profiles create demand for highly adaptable equipment. European buyers, in particular, are sensitive to energy efficiency, hygiene-by-design, and lifecycle environmental impacts, while markets in the Middle East and Africa often prioritize localized training and field service capabilities due to broader geographic distribution and variable infrastructure. European regulatory frameworks and buyer-led sustainability commitments are pushing suppliers to innovate around recyclable materials and energy-efficient motors.

Asia-Pacific presents a contrasting set of opportunities driven by rapidly evolving retail formats, expanding foodservice networks, and a mix of artisanal and industrial dairy production. High-growth urban centers are increasing demand for compact countertop units and modular automatic solutions that can scale with outlet expansion. At the same time, the region's dense manufacturing network offers suppliers cost-effective component sourcing, although buyers may place additional value on local service footprints and certified compliance with regional food safety standards. Across regions, the interplay between distribution logistics, local technical support, and regulatory expectations remains the decisive factor in commercial adoption.

Analysis of competitive differentiation showing how hygienic engineering, modular portfolios, and aftermarket service models determine supplier strength and partnership opportunities

Competitive dynamics are shaped by a mixture of specialist manufacturers, OEMs with broader food-processing portfolios, and regional fabricators that focus on cost-optimized units. Leading suppliers differentiate through demonstrable hygienic engineering, modularity for multi-cheese handling, and comprehensive aftermarket programs that include installation, training, and spare-parts availability. These capabilities are increasingly important as buyers prioritize uptime, regulatory compliance, and predictable lifecycle costs.

At the same time, market entry by small, specialized vendors has increased pressure on established providers to accelerate product updates and to offer tiered portfolios that span from countertop and manual units to fully integrated industrial solutions. The aftermarket service proposition, including preventive maintenance plans and refurbishment options, has become a key competitive lever. Firms that can provide transparent documentation on material provenance, cleaning validation, and energy consumption are more likely to secure long-term contracts with large processors and foodservice chains.

Partnerships between equipment manufacturers and ingredient or packaging suppliers are also emerging as a way to bundle solutions for customers seeking end-to-end process improvements. These collaborations often produce joint offerings that reduce integration risk and provide buyers with an aligned single-point supplier for specific line segments. The competitive implication is clear: firms that invest in cross-functional partnerships and extended service guarantees strengthen customer lock-in and differentiate on the basis of reduced operational risk.
